Which digital currencies can be traded using forex instruments?
Can you provide a list of digital currencies that can be traded using forex instruments? I'm interested in knowing which cryptocurrencies are available for trading on forex platforms.

Some of the popular digital currencies that can be traded using forex instruments include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Ripple (XRP), Litecoin (LTC), and Bitcoin Cash (BCH). These cryptocurrencies are widely accepted on forex platforms and offer opportunities for traders to speculate on their price movements against traditional fiat currencies like the US Dollar, Euro, or Japanese Yen. It's important to note that availability may vary depending on the forex broker or platform you choose, so it's always a good idea to check with your broker for the specific cryptocurrencies they offer for trading.
